The size of Belmont is approximately 4.4 square kilometres. There are 10 parks, covering nearly 4.4% of the total area. The population of Belmont in 2016 was 6785 people. By 2021 the population was 6959 showing a population growth of 2.6%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Belmont is 30-39 years. Households in Belmont are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Belmont work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 52.50% of the homes in Belmont were owner-occupied compared with 54.40% in 2016.
Belmont has 4,675 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Belmont have seen a 95.11% increase in median value, while Units have seen a 90.06% increase. As at 31 July 2026:
